(a) In the modern periodic table, which are the metals among the first ten elements?

(b) What is the significance of atomic number in the modern classification of elements? Explain with the help of an example.

1 Answer
0

(a) Lithium, Beryllium are metals.

(b) The real significance of atomic number in the modern periodic classification is that it relates the periodicity in the properties of elements to the periodicity in their electronic configurations.

Example: The atomic number increases from 3 in lithium to 11 in sodium, there is a repetition of electronic configuration from 2, 1 to 2, 8, 1 (both having 1 valence electron).
